Technical Field
The utility model relates to an oxygen mask specifically is an oxygen mask for respiratory medicine.
Background
Oxygen inhalation is a main mode for treating respiratory system diseases, a nasal catheter method is mostly adopted in hospitals at present, but a catheter is easy to fall off or block, the treatment effect is influenced, and a lot of inconvenience is brought to patients losing neck mobility.
When a patient uses the oxygen mask to exhale and inhale, and the patient losing neck mobility is fed, a nursing staff needs to take off the oxygen mask and can feed liquid food to the patient by using an auxiliary tool, so that the treatment of the patient is not facilitated, the feeding difficulty and the working strength of medical staff are increased, and the oxygen mask for the respiratory medicine is provided.

Referring to fig. 1 to 5, in an embodiment of the present invention, an oxygen mask for respiratory medicine includes a cover 1, a flow guiding funnel 2, a temporary storage chamber 3, a composite hose 4, a first fixture block 5, an oxygen port 6, a clamping groove 7, an intake port 8, a ventilation port 9, an oxygen mask body 10, a strap 11, a nose-shaped cavity 12, a sealing flange 13, a fixing platform 14, a second fixture block 15, a telescopic rod 16, a fixing block 17, an oxygen output tube 18, and an intake tube 19.
The oxygen mask body 10 is fixedly connected with a nose-shaped cavity 12, the oxygen mask body 10 and the nose-shaped cavity 12 are integrally formed, the oxygen mask body 10 and the nose-shaped cavity 12 are made of transparent plastics, one side of the nose-shaped cavity 12 is provided with an oxygen port 6, a clamping groove 7 and a feeding opening 8, the oxygen port 6 is internally provided with internal threads, the number of the clamping grooves 7 is two, the two clamping grooves 7 are symmetrically distributed at two sides of the food inlet 8, the bottoms of the two clamping grooves 7 are fixedly connected together through a welding positioning plate, the clamping grooves 7 are bonded on the nose-shaped cavity 12 through glue, when the first clamping block 5 is clamped into the clamping grooves 7, the nose-shaped cavity 12 is provided with two symmetrical air vents 9 for limiting and fixing, an air filter screen is arranged on the air vents 9, when a patient breathes, carbon dioxide is discharged and tiny particles in the air are blocked, so that the respiratory tract of a patient is prevented from being secondarily damaged.
The oxygen mask is characterized in that two symmetrical belts 11 are installed on the oxygen mask body 10 through bolts, a sealing convex edge 13 is installed at the edge of the oxygen mask body 10, a protective sleeve wraps the sealing convex edge 13, the protective sleeve is made of rubber materials, and the protective sleeve can be better attached to the face of a patient.
The oxygen port 6 is provided with a fixing device, the fixing device is composed of a fixing table 14, two fixture blocks 15, an expansion link 16, a fixing block 17 and an oxygen output pipe 18, the fixing table 14 is a cube, four fixing blocks 17 are vertically welded on the surface of one side of the fixing table 14, a through hole is formed in the fixing table 14, the expansion link 16 is transversely installed on one side of the center of the through hole corresponding to the fixing block 17, one end of the expansion link 16 is fixedly connected to the fixing block 17, the other end of the expansion link 16 is welded with the two fixture blocks 15, a compression spring is installed on the expansion link 16, the number of the two fixture blocks 15 is four, the shape of the two fixture blocks 15 is arc, the four two fixture blocks 15 are combined into a ring-shaped fixture mechanism, the through hole on one side of the fixing table 14 is fixedly connected with an input port of the, when a patient needs to deliver oxygen, the oxygen port 6 is screwed into the fixing device, the oxygen tube is inserted into the through hole and is fixed by the clamp, and therefore the situation that the oxygen tube deforms due to rotation to cause the reduction or blockage of the oxygen output quantity is avoided.
The feeding device is arranged on the feeding port 8 and comprises a cover 1, a flow guide hopper 2, a temporary storage chamber 3, a composite hose 4, a first clamping block 5 and a feeding pipe 19, a through hole is formed in one side of the temporary storage chamber 3, the flow guide hopper 2 is arranged on the through hole, the cover 1 is rotatably connected onto the flow guide hopper 2 through a hinge, the cover 1 and the flow guide hopper 2 are fixedly clamped together through a buckle, the through hole is formed in one side of the temporary storage chamber 3 corresponding to the flow guide hopper 2, an input port of the feeding pipe 19 is fixedly connected with the through hole, the feeding pipe 19 is made of medical catheter silicon rubber, a positioning bolt is arranged at the top of the first clamping block 5, the through hole is formed in the first clamping block 5, the diameter of the through hole is larger than that of the feeding pipe 19, the feeding pipe 19 is slidably connected onto the first clamping block 5, the composite hose 4 is sleeved on the feeding pipe 19, one end of the composite hose 4 is fixedly connected onto, another port fixed connection of compound hose 4 is on a side surface of fixture block 5, link together temporary storage chamber 3 and fixture block 5, make into esophagus 19 and can freely slide out compound hose 4 and fixture block 5, when need feed for your patient, in inserting into card groove 7 with a fixture block 5, then will advance in the gentle propulsion patient's of esophagus 19 mouth, through the circumstances in observing, then the swivel bolt, make into the fixed position that wants of esophagus 19, open lid 1 and feed for patient.
